PPG, private creditors in China
China: PPG, private creditors was 22.45 billion NFL, US$ in 2024. ◆ Volatile
PPG, private creditors in China, 1981–2024
Source: International Debt Statistics, World Bank (WB). Measured in NFL, US$.
Analysis
In 2024, ppg, private creditors in China stood at 22.45 billion NFL, US$.
That represents a change of up 145.9% on the previous year and down 22.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, ppg, private creditors in China peaked at 169.20 billion NFL, US$ in 2021 and was at its lowest, -48.93 billion NFL, US$, in 2023.
China ranks 1st of 119 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 2.42 billion NFL, US$ | -120.51 million NFL, US$ | 5.46 billion NFL, US$ | 9 |
| 1990s | 4.64 billion NFL, US$ | -1.91 billion NFL, US$ | 8.75 billion NFL, US$ | 10 |
| 2000s | -830.63 million NFL, US$ | -4.06 billion NFL, US$ | 2.36 billion NFL, US$ | 10 |
| 2010s | 27.32 billion NFL, US$ | -1.68 billion NFL, US$ | 66.14 billion NFL, US$ | 10 |
| 2020s | 41.26 billion NFL, US$ | -48.93 billion NFL, US$ | 169.20 billion NFL, US$ | 5 |

About this data
Public and publicly guaranteed debt from private creditors include bonds that are either publicly issued or privately placed; commercial bank loans from private banks and other private financial institutions; and other private credits from manufacturers, exporters, and other suppliers of goods, and bank credits covered by a guarantee of an export credit agency. Net flows (or net lending or net disbursements) received by the borrower during the year are disbursements minus principal repayments. Data are in current U.S. dollars.
